The Landscape of App Store Algorithms
When users search for apps in the App Store, they expect to find relevant and popular options. However, the algorithms that determine search rankings often favor larger, well-established companies over smaller, independent developers. This shift not only affects app visibility but also impacts revenue and growth opportunities for these smaller entities.
The Dominance of Larger Brands
The algorithms are designed to prioritize apps with higher download rates and user ratings. As a result, larger brands have a significant advantage:
- Increased budget for marketing campaigns.
- Established user bases that naturally drive downloads.
- Exclusive partnerships with platform providers that boost visibility.
These factors make it increasingly difficult for small developers to compete, even if their apps offer unique features or better user experiences.
The Direct Impact on Small Independent Developers
Due to these unfair advantages, many small developers find themselves struggling to gain traction in a crowded market. Here are some critical challenges they face:
- Reduced Visibility: Being buried in search results leads to fewer downloads and visibility.
- Financial Constraints: Limited budgets prevent effective marketing and outreach efforts.
- Innovation Stifling: Many talented developers may abandon their projects due to a lack of support and recognition.
This situation raises questions about the sustainability of a diverse app ecosystem that is vital for innovation and user choice.
Strategies for Small Developers
Despite these challenges, small developers can adopt several strategies to improve their chances of success:
- Focus on Niche Markets: Finding and targeting specific user segments can help developers build loyal customer bases.
- Optimize App Store Listings: Effective use of SEO techniques can improve app visibility in search results.
- Leverage Social Media: Building a presence on social platforms can drive organic traffic to their apps.
In addition to these strategies, collaborations and partnerships with other small developers or influencers can enhance visibility and credibility.
